  • Must visit

Beamish, The Living Museum of the North

Museum in nearby Beamish presenting North East life through reconstructed streets, homes and transport. A major day trip from Durham.

  • Recommended

Oriental Museum

University museum with collections from ancient civilisations to world cultures. Compact, varied and easy to combine with a cathedral visit.

  • Recommended

Palace Green Library

Gallery and museum at Palace Green with changing exhibitions and displays connected to Durham’s history, books and university collections.

Pound sterling (£)

Moderate for the UK. Hotels and dining are usually cheaper than London, while local buses and casual meals stay fairly reasonable for visitors.

Average meal costs

Budget
£8-15 for fast food or a simple lunch.
Mid-range
£18-30 per person for a restaurant meal.
Fine dining
£50+ per person for upscale dining.
Coffee
£3-4 for a cappuccino.

Tipping culture

Tipping is modest. In restaurants, 10-12.5% is usual if service is not included. Round up taxi fares. Cafés do not expect tips, but small change is appreciated.
